CPU Cooler/Heatsink with Fan (HSF) = undecided whether to go air or water cooling (close loop) for the i7 5930k
If you're planning to overclock and want some semblance of quiet, I would look at the H100i GTX:
$112 - Corsair Hydro H100i GTX Liquid CPU Cooler

If you're planning to overclock and don't care about noise, the Seidon 120M isn't a terrible choice:
$90 - Coolermaster Sedon 240M Liquid CPU Cooler

If you're not planning to overclock and want as low noise as reasonable possible, I would look at these HSF:
$47 - Scythe SCKTT-1000 HSF
$76 - Noctua NH-D14 HSF

If you're not planning to overclock and don't care too much about noise, then I recommend this HSF:
$31 - Cooler Master Hyper 212 Evo HSF

If you're planning to overclock and want as low noise as possible, I don't really have a recommendation for you as I don't think any HSF that's quiet by SilentPCReview standards is going to be enough cooling for an overclocked 5930K.

Memory (RAM) = thinking about getting Corsair Dominator DDR4 2666 4x4 16gb/open to suggestions
Dominator RAM in general are rarely worth buying. Not to mention that a 4 x4 set means a more costly future RAM upgrade down the line if you want to use more than 48GB of RAM. I recommend getting this cheaper Corsair 2 x 8GB DDR4 2666 RAM set instead:
